Fly Little Bird
How could those little wing,
Endure such a force,
Of the merciless rain,
Beating with stone drops coarse.
How could those little feathers,
Endure the heavy weight,
Of the drops so heavy,
As one by one peace they await.
How could those little birds,
Endure such hardships,
And yet with such happiness,
Give those uplifting chirps and cheeps?
